Spring Risotto
This is not the fastest of all side dishes, but the medley of flavors is wonderful in this recipe. As all other risotto recipes I've tried, it takes a lot of attention and preparation. However, if you pre-chop everything and have it all ready to go, assembly is not difficult. I used orange pepper instead of red and vegatable boullion in cubes mixed with water, and it turned out nicely. A nice, springy dish... I fixed it with Robust Baked Garlic Chicken and it went together very well.

Robust Garlic Baked Chicken
This recipe is wonderful, and as easy as baking a chicken normally is. It is nice, due to the nice medley of fresh herbs and lemon. One note, I didn't add all the butter mixture to the chicken, as it was quite a lot. Half of the mixture (with the full amount of herbs, just half the butter) works wonderfully as well. Or make the full batch, and use the rest of the herb butter for bread, etc. Additionally, I did not have kitchen twine, and so used dental floss (clean, of course!) and it worked perfectly! Not the quickest of recipes, it is a crowd pleaser.

Spinach Quiche
This quiche is really easy to make, although a little time consuming. I really liked that it make more than one quiche, so I could freeze the extra one for later use. I made this recipe for my co-workers, and I received nothing but compliments. One suggestion I have is to use more eggs, as I found only 4 eggs does not fill up two pie crusts. I would suggest 6 or 7 eggs total. Otherwise, I also like this recipe since it is easy to add or subtract ingredients as well. I added 1/2 lb cooked bacon to the recipe and it made for a nice addition. Perhaps the best part... the finished product looks impressive, but it's very easy!
